Family and Education
bap. 7 July 1682, 2nd but 1st surv. s. Francis Howard, 5th Bar. Howard of Effingham, and Philadelphia, da. of Sir Thomas Pelham‡, bt. of Laughton, Suss; bro. of Francis Howard†, later earl of Effingham. Collins Peerage (1812), v. 280. educ. travelled abroad 1701–2 (Italy and Austia). CSP Dom. 1700–2, p. 349; HMC Buccleuch, ii. 764–5. m. (1) 25 Feb. 1707, Mary (d.1718), da. and h. of Ruishe Wentworth of Sarre, Kent, and Ireland, 2da.; (2) 25 Jan. 1722, Elizabeth (d.1741), da. of John Rotherham of Much Waltham, Essex, and wid. of Sir Theophilus Napier, 5th bt. s.p. d. 10 July 1725; will 14 May 1725, pr. 5 Aug. 1725. TNA, PROB 11/604.
Offices Held
Gent. of the bedchamber to Prince George, of Denmark, 1706 – 08.
Officer, 1st tp. of Horse Gds. 1706.
